    Charlene H.

    The service was attentive and quick. I had beef vermicelli and the hubs had shrimp pho. We shared spring rolls. With my vermicelli I also received an egg roll and a shrimp sugarcane roll (maybe not called a roll but anyhow...). The beef was super flavorful and tender. Really good flavor. I did need to use some of my husbands broth because the noodles have zero sauce on them at all. I guess I was expecting something on them so they weren't just a clump of noodles. That being said, with a little broth they were really nice. I definitely prefer the spring rolls to the egg roll. The spring rolls are crunchy and flavorful but the egg roll lacked a crunchiness and felt a little mushy inside. The shrimp sugarcane thing was ok. Probably an acquired taste. The vegetables in my vermicelli bowl were super fresh and crunchy. Overall I really liked the beef vermicelli bowl...with a bit of broth. It was light and satisfying. The shrimp pho was good. The shrimp were nice and big and nicely cooked. I had hot tea, as well. It was fresh and hit the spot. Overall, I really enjoyed the meal. If you're in Rosenberg, give them a try. You won't regret it.

    Thomas K.

    I love to discover little places like this that I really didn't discover (it's apparently been around forever and it's actually quite spacious). However with all that being said you really wouldn't expect Rosenberg TX to be the location of a great Pho restaurant however it is and Country Pho is it. The location in a strip center is unassuming however the efficiency of the service the flavor and ingredients of the Pho and the versatility of the menu beyond Pho make it well worth the stop if you find yourself in the neighborhood...oh and I might add...the reasonable prices given the quality of the food makes it even more of an excellent proposition. I had Pho Dac Biet and found the broth rich with flavor and the ingredients plentiful and in ample variety sufficient to satisfy any palate. In addition, the Jalapeño's were fresh, crisp and spicy along with the bean sprouts and greens. If you enjoy Pho do not hesitate to stop here. It is well worth the experience.
